No Right to Change Buildings Address Sample Clauses

No Right to Change Buildings Address. Landlord shall have no ------------------------------------ right to change the street address of the Buildings occupied by Tenant without the prior written consent of Tenant. Landlord reserves the right to change the name of the Project and/or any Building(s) therein.

No Right to Change Buildings Address. Landlord shall have no right to change the street address of the Fab I Building without the prior written consent of Tenant. Landlord reserves the right to change the name of the Project.
No Right to Change Buildings Address. Landlord shall have no right to change the street address of the Conference Center without the prior written consent of Tenant. Landlord reserves the right to change the name of the Project.
